Renalith Saga (レナリスサーガ), developed by CHERIS SOFT, is a classic-style fantasy adventure that follows the journey of Lenaris, a former nun whose peaceful life is shattered by the tides of war. Version 1.02 represents a polished state of this title, refining the experience of reclaiming a lost home in a world torn between humans and demons. The Story: A Nun’s Great Adventure

The narrative centers on the border village of Iris, where Lenaris once lived a quiet, devout life. When the conflict between humanity and demonkind escalates, she is thrust from her sanctuary and into the role of a traveler. The "Saga" follows her "great adventure" to return to and reclaim her hometown, a journey that pits her against a variety of supernatural threats. Gameplay Mechanics

The game blends traditional RPG exploration with strategic combat encounters. Players navigate a world where the primary goal is reclamation, encountering unique boss fights that test both preparation and tactics.

Boss Encounters: Key early hurdles include formidable foes like the Big Rat and the Chewing Slime, which serve as introductory challenges to the game's combat system.

Version 1.02 Enhancements: Typical for CHERIS SOFT updates, this version focuses on stabilizing the experience and ensuring that the narrative flow—from the border village to the final reclamation—is seamless for the player. Why It Resonates

Renalith Saga captures the charm of "reclamation" stories, where the stakes are deeply personal. Rather than just saving the world, Lenaris is fighting for the specific streets and neighbors she knew in Iris. This grounded motivation, combined with the developer's distinct style, makes it a notable entry for fans of character-driven fantasy RPGs.
